# Artifact Signing — Nightshade Backfill Scheduler

All nightly backfill scheduler builds ship signed. CI at Torvane produces the tarball; the release manager signs it before promotion to the Quillmere registry. Unsigned artifacts are rejected by the runner. Verify signatures on every promotion, no exceptions. Rotate quarterly; old keys go to the revocation list. For current releases, sign using the key below.

signing key of bagap-yawep = bky13_TbfT6ZMUoGJo2

**Ticket: Ledger sync creds expired (again)**

Heads up, new folks — the PointsKeeper loyalty ledger stopped syncing overnight because the service credential for the Tallyvault API hit its 90-day expiry. This happens quarterly, so bookmark this ticket. Rotation is done; the old key is revoked, so update your local env files before running any ledger backfills. The fresh key for the Tallyvault staging tier is below.

gateway credential: kto3_qfe

**FAQ: Archiving Cold Storage Buckets (Glacierline Tier)**

Q: How do we archive a customer's cold storage bucket?

A: Flag the bucket in Vaultwright Console, confirm no active retrieval jobs, then run the archive sweep. Retention defaults to 7 years. Customer must acknowledge the freeze notice before we proceed. Restores require ticket escalation to Tier 2 — no exceptions.

For test-environment restores only, use the shared recovery passphrase below.

strongbox words: caswyn-druwyn

Sales leads should note: existing customers keep monthly terms until renewal; new contracts default to annual with a 10% incentive. Quota credit is recognized at signature, not collection, so pipeline math changes — see the updated comp sheet. Expect pushback from smaller accounts; an approved exception process exists but requires director sign-off. Handle objections with the standard talk track. The reasoning behind the shift is recorded below.

management briefing: Project Ulavan slips by two quarters because of the staffing delay.